877-662-6988This outstanding central Bergamo hotel accommodation is located right in the heart of the city, close to the central railway station and the cable car station leading to the città alta, the highest part of the town, with its medieval treasures.
Its 89 bedrooms are tastefully furnished and radiate a cosy and intimate atmosphere. Among the hotel's facilities you will find a meeting room, a restaurant (closed on Sunday and Saturday for lunch), an American bar (open from 3 p.m. to midnight), a gym, and a sauna.
The reception is open 24 hours a day and features a luggage deposit. A free wireless Internet connection is available throughout the hotel.

A tax is imposed by the city and collected at the property in cash. The tax ranges from EUR 0.50 to EUR 4 per person, per night. The amount has been determined by the local administration and depends on the length of stay, property classification, and room price. This tax does not apply from the 11th consecutive night of stay onwards, to residents of Bergamo, disabled persons, or children under 16 years of age if accompanied by an adult who is subject to the tax. As many budget airlines fly in late to Bergamo Airport (eg. Ryanair from UK), staying in Bergamo is a better option than travelling on to Milan late at night on the shuttle bus. This hotel is very conveniently located in the centre of Bergamo and only 15 minutes by bus from the airport terminal. Take bus no. 1 and get off at the next stop after the railway station on Viale Papa Giovanni which is directly opposite the hotel (fare 1.30 euro). Bus no.1 for the return to the airport stops directly outside the hotel and goes every 30 mins or it is a 300m walk back to the railway station for trains onwards to Milan Centrale or other destinations. The city bus tour also stops outside the hotel every 1 hour and is a good and quick way to explore the city. If you don't intend to spend much time in your hotel then the Best Western Cappello d'Oro would be a very good choice for a short stay in Bergamo. It is clean and functional. The rooms although a bit on the small side are perfectly adequate, the breakfast is very good and the reception staff are polite and speak English. Bergamo has an interesting old upper city and is a good place for a short break or an overnight stop before moving on to the Italian Lakes. We would stay here again and recommend this hotel.

How to reach Best Western Premier Cappello D'Oro Hotel
By carFrom the A4/E64 highway heading towards Bergamo/Brescia/Verona, exit at Bergamo, proceed for around 1.4 km, then turn right into via Autostrada and follow for 1.2 km. Turn right into via Costantino Simoncini, left into via Geremia Bonomelli, then left again into Viale Papa Giovanni XXIII where the property is located at number 12.
By train
The Bergamo railway station is only 300 metres away.
By airplane
The hotel lies around 4 km from the Orio al Serio airport. Take a taxi or the ATB Bergamo Airport Shuttle which offers a daily service to and from the city and stops directly in front of the property. To use this service, it is necessary to purchase an ATB bus ticket (type C), which costs €1,50 and is to be validated once on board.
